Been reading and looking for about 4 months. I own 2, 2002’s, do most of the work on them, and want a 535i as a daily driver. Probably about 5,000 miles a year. Found one in Washington State owned by a guy who I believe has done an excellent job caring for the car. Complete records from day 1.

The good: stock engine, re-finished leather, near mint interior, 5-speed, straight body. No rust. Don’t think it has ever been abused.
The bad: slight shimmy from 40 to 50, then it goes away, speedo doesn’t work, paint is showing it’s age with clear coat going on trunk. Ugly, cheap wheels. 212,000 miles and hasn’t been rebuilt.

asking price is $3200. I was thinking of getting a one-over at a local shop for compression and if no suprises offering $2500. Any thoughts or advice?

I WOULD NOT BE OVERLY CONCERNED WITH THE SPEEDO BECAUSE IT IS MOST LIKELY A 5-7 DOLLAR FIX OF NEW BATTERIES IN THE CIRCUIT BOARD OF THE SPEEDO, THE SHIMMY IS MOST LIKELY A BAD U-JOINT, AS YOU PROBABLY KNOW, YOU NEED A REBUILT DRIVE SHAFT FOR THIS FIX AS BMW U-JOINTS ARE NEARLY IMPOSSIBLE TO REPLACE WITHOUT MANY YEARS OF PRACTICE. THE ENGINE IS IN ALL BUT THE RAREST CIRCUMSTANCES GOING TO SEE THE LIONS SHARE OF 300,000+ MILES IF LUBRICANT IS CHANGED REGUARLY (MY 533I HAS ALMOST 490 THOUSAND MILES AND STILL PURRS LIKE A KITTEN). THE PAINT WILL BE THE MOST ANNOYING AREA BECAUSE IT WILL NEED TO BE SANDED DOWN AND THEN REPAINTED,..- NO $190 MACCO PAINT JOBS THAT FLAKE OFF LIKE DANDRUFF AFTER 5-MONTHS EITHER, A BMW DESERVES A DECENT PAINT JOB. THE PRICE DOESNT JUMP OUT AS A GREAT PRICE, BUT NOT OVERLY EXPENSIVE EITHER.
